Wow you guys even made a new folder for greedy slobs like me :-)

I have 3 page hard plastic DR slate that i wear on my wrist.
- i cut off that little plastic lug that clutters the wrist space and catches line under it.
- after some use the writing surface becomes "glossy" the led pencil slips and writing is not sharp anymore. Use 100 sandpaper on on plastic pages and it will be perfect.
- did you buy that slate\mask cleaner in diveshop? Dude, this is just Aquafresh toothpaste in smaller and more expensive package
- velcro wrist strap is a good place to put your DR Z-knife on and its sheath is a pocket for that hanging pencil

I've always used "SoftScrub" to clean a grooty slate when an eraser won't do the job...same stuff gets mold release out of a new mask...

Good hints re the Z-knife mount and how to not buy a pencil per Dive...my only fault with the DR slate is being a wetsuit wearer, suit compression leads to the slate ending up on my WRIST at depth...
